What Makes Sports App Development Different
Sports app development isn't really about the scoreboard screen. It's about whatever the app has to receive and process fast, live score feeds, play-by-play events, fantasy scoring calculations, all while staying accurate enough that a fan trusts the number on their screen matches what's actually happening in the game. Get the data latency wrong and the app becomes the one fans check second, after a competitor already told them the score.
Most sports app failures aren't design failures. They're latency failures, an app that looks polished in a demo but takes thirty seconds to reflect a real scoring play, or a fantasy scoring engine that calculates points correctly but a full quarter behind the actual game. As a sports app development company, we treat that real-time data pipeline as the actual hard problem, not the UI sitting on top of it.

Explore →01 How much does custom sports app development cost?
It depends mainly on how much of the build involves real-time data feeds and live streaming versus a simpler stats-display app. A basic scores-and-stats app costs far less than a full platform with fantasy scoring, live streaming, and team management. Scope the data integrations first, then the price becomes predictable.
02 How do you keep live scores and stats updating in real time?
We integrate with established sports data providers and build the app's architecture around low-latency delivery, tested against real game-day traffic, not just a quiet staging environment. This is the piece of sports app development companies most often underinvest in.
03 Can you build a fantasy sports scoring engine?
Yes. Fantasy scoring logic is built and load-tested to calculate correctly under real concurrent usage during live games, not just in a demo with a handful of test accounts.
04 Do you build both the fan-facing app and the backend?
Yes. Sports apps live or die on real-time data reliability, so we design the backend and data-feed integrations alongside the app rather than treating it as a separate problem.
05 How long does it take to build a sports app?
A focused app, like a basic live-scores tool, can launch in a few months. A full platform with fantasy sports, live streaming, and team management takes considerably longer, largely because of real-time load testing, not the app code itself.
